Account recovery — SweepClean orphan sweeper (Vantor Systems). If the sweeper service account is locked, do not recreate it; orphaned-resource tagging depends on its principal ID. Restore via the Vantor recovery console: select the sweeper role, confirm the last successful sweep timestamp, and re-enable. Audit log entry is mandatory. Reviewer must verify no resources were deleted during lockout. To complete restoration, enter the recovery passphrase exactly as recorded below.

strongbox words: eliius-pelath-sorius-oliys-noviel

Subject: Pinning cut-over done

Hey Marit,

Quick wrap-up: the Fernwheel build pipeline is now fully on the strict dependency pinning policy as of last night. No more floating minor versions — everything resolves from the locked manifest, and the nightly drift check will flag anything unpinned. Two stragglers in the reporting service got pinned manually; Devan has the details. Rollback path is documented in the release wiki. The current resolver settings we shipped with are as follows.

settings of kahap-kahof:
[aldvan]
port = 6379
team = istox
host = aldvan.plorvalabs.internal
region = west-1
access_code = ac_e12344
timeout_ms = 2000

Welcome to the Lattico platform team. Every request entering Bridgeway gateway receives a trace ID propagated through all downstream services, including Ledgerette and Plumeflow. When debugging, always correlate spans in the Kestrelview dashboard before filing a ticket. Access to Kestrelview's break-glass tracing account, used only during incidents, is unlocked with the recovery passphrase recorded directly below this paragraph.

recovery phrase for fajep-yaweg: gilath-sorox-wenius-rusdor-keliel-zorius

Autocomplete on Harrowgate search is slow; known issue. The Plume index rebuilds nightly and serves stale prefixes until noon. Root cause: single-threaded trie construction plus an unbounded synonym expansion step. Reviewers: reject changes that add synonyms without a cap, and flag any query touching the trie during rebuild. A fix is scheduled for the Q3 index rewrite. Benchmarks and the rewrite proposal are on the page below.

operations page: https://confluence.qorvellabs.internal/pages/projects/projects/projects